Dr. Mahalakshmi Sankar has been working as an Assistant Professor at Albertian Institute of Management, Kochi, Kerala. 

Albertian Institute of Management


What are the key factors that keep you connected with the education sector?

"The impact my knowledge and experience has in my students life have kept me associated"

Before joining AIM, I was the Department Head of Management Studies for more than 20 years in a reputed college in Mumbai and while working there for so long, I was able to enhance the capabilities of average and below average students to a great extent by using the approach of experiential learning. And the fact which has kept me associated with the education sector is my passion to educate youths and I believe the work I do being a faculty has a deep and good impact on my students life, which itself is a satisfactory and joyful feeling.

How do you bring in a practical and industry oriented approach towards subjects?

"By encouraging students to develop projects on real world issues"

We have established students oriented and innovative teaching learning methodology in our college. For example, our students have training materials for hygiene as well as emotional well-being to welcome students and faculty back to the institute premises post Covid pandemic. Similarly a mock global investors summit was organized under the aegis of our college entrepreneurship cell for students.

What challenges are you facing to uplift the education quality of your college?

"Students have become lazy towards their studies and addicted towards their phones"

The 2 years covid pandemic has induced lethargy amongst the students and have also created addiction of technology and mobile phones, and these two in my opinion are the biggest challenge we need to address on an earliest basis. Hence, to make classroom learning more interactive and fun and also to inculcate interest in students towards their studies, I keep the teaching-learning environment very light and humorous.
